Description of the invention (l) The technical field to which the invention belongs The present invention relates to a multi-conversion communication module and a basic wireless communication unit that can be used, especially a device that can be used, and can be used as required Conversion to different modes = multiple different functions. With the advancement of technology, the transmission mode of information, the mode of transmission over the wire, and the advancement to the wireless transmission mode = ^ has the convenience of carrying and transmitting data. This also makes people more and more close. 'Using wireless technology': distance is also a specific point for data transmission and access limitations (for example, restaurants, mountains, seaside, etc.), "; Any place (for example, on an airplane or a train) ^ In the mobile state, 'big ^' increases the convenience of long-distance communication and data exchange. It is used for the purpose of transmission in poor water. For wireless communication, Includes digital mobile phones, mobile phones, green kappa, and flat season cranes: unieatiQns (GSM), General Packet Radio Service (GpRS), Bluetooth (Bluetoot ^ i), and wireless networks (Wireless Un) and so on. Existing wireless communication cards that are known for wireless transmission are often used in portable computers ^ PDA's / ϋσ as expansion devices for wireless transmission, so that they can be connected to the Internet through a wireless connection system. The conventional portable wireless communication cartoon crane sets all necessary components, such as a wireless communication module (for example, GSM, GPRS, wireless network, or Bluetooth wireless, etc.), on a motherboard.

Those who are familiar with the present invention can make some improvements and modifications, but still do not depart from the scope of the present invention. ^ Embodiments The purpose and effects of the present invention are described in detail below with reference to the drawings. . Refer to:-Figure, which is a schematic diagram of a multi-conversion communication module device according to the present invention. The multi-conversion communication module device of the present invention includes a main board (1) and a daughter board (2), wherein the main board (1) is further configured with a plurality of
元件,至少包含:一多工控制器(1丨)、一電子可抹寫程式 唯讀記憶體(EleCtricaily Erasable Pr〇grammg:ble ReadComponents, including at least: a multiplex controller (1 丨), an electronic rewritable program, read-only memory (EleCtricaily Erasable Pr〇grammg: ble Read
Only Memory,PPROM) (12)、一 SSD 裝置橋接晶片(s〇Hd Static Disk device bridge chip) (13)、一無線通訊模 組(14)及一連接器a (15)。其中,多工控制器(11)進一步 包含:一排線FO(lll)及一排線!^1(112)。其中該無線通訊 板組(14),為一可替換模組,其至少包 gsm、GPRS或藍芽無線模組等,但不僅限於此^路Only Memory (PPROM) (12), an SSD device bridge chip (socHd Static Disk device bridge chip) (13), a wireless communication module (14), and a connector a (15). Among them, the multiplexing controller (11) further includes: a row of lines FO (ll1) and a row of lines! ^ 1 (112). The wireless communication board group (14) is a replaceable module, which includes at least gsm, GPRS or Bluetooth wireless module, but is not limited to this.
子板(2 )亦設置有複數個元件,其至少包含:一電子 2抹寫耘式唯讀記憶體(2 4)及一連接器B ( 2 5 )。另外可依 H同、需_求於子板(2)中進一步設置一電池組(21)(參閱第 ^ "、一記憶卡轉接器(adapter) (22)(參閱第三圖)或一 f、、泉通訊模組(23)(參閱第ώ圖),三者至少豆中之一,以 、、且裳^不同形式之模組化子板(2)。 ’、 月)述所指出的記憶轉接器(2 2 ),可使用之記憶卡包含The daughter board (2) is also provided with a plurality of components, which at least include: an electronic 2 erasing read-only memory (2 4) and a connector B (2 5). In addition, a battery pack (21) can be further set in the daughter board (2) according to the same requirements (see section ^ ", a memory card adapter (22) (see the third figure) or F. Spring communication module (23) (see the free chart). At least one of the three is a modular daughter board (2) in different forms. 第7頁 1222827 五、發明說明(4) 但不僅限於MMC(MultiMedia Card)、SD(Safe Digital)或 MS(Mem〇ry Stick)記憶卡;無線通訊模組(23)包含但不僅 限於然線網路或藍芽無線卡,其亦可以一全球定位系統 (Global Positioning System,GPS)晶片取代之。 因此,子板(2)有可能的組合可舉例出如(a)電池組; (b)記憶.卡轉接器;(c)無線網路卡;(d)記憶卡轉接器+電 池組,(e)电池組+監芽無線卡;(f )電池組+無線網路卡; 或(g)電池組+ GPS卡,但不僅限於此。Page 7 1222827 V. Description of the invention (4) But not limited to MMC (MultiMedia Card), SD (Safe Digital) or MS (Memory Stick) memory card; wireless communication module (23) includes but is not limited to wireless network Or a Bluetooth wireless card, which can also be replaced by a Global Positioning System (GPS) chip. Therefore, the possible combinations of daughter boards (2) can be exemplified as (a) battery pack; (b) memory. Card adapter; (c) wireless network card; (d) memory card adapter + battery pack , (E) battery pack + monitor bud wireless card; (f) battery pack + wireless network card; or (g) battery pack + GPS card, but it is not limited to this.
亦即,當以前述具有不同種類通訊模組之母卡插入經 模組化之子卡時,即可成為一多變換通訊模組裝置。在此 可舉出的例子,包含:(a)母板··無線網路,子卡··記憶 卡(SD、MMC或MS)轉接器;(b)母板:GSM或GPRS,子卡· 無線網路;(c)母板:藍芽無線,子板:記憶卡(SD、mmc 或MS)轉接器+電池組;(d)母板·· GSM *GpRS,子卡· GPS+電池組;(e)母板:無線網路,子卡··記憶卡(仰、 MMC或MS)轉接器+電池組,但不僅限於此。That is, when the mother card with different types of communication modules is inserted into the modularized daughter card, it can become a multi-conversion communication module device. Examples that can be cited here include: (a) Motherboard ... Wireless network, daughter card ... Memory card (SD, MMC or MS) adapter; (b) Motherboard: GSM or GPRS, daughter card · Wireless network; (c) Mother board: Bluetooth wireless, daughter board: memory card (SD, mmc or MS) adapter + battery pack; (d) mother board · · GSM * GpRS, daughter card · GPS + battery (E) Motherboard: wireless network, daughter card · memory card (Yang, MMC or MS) adapter + battery pack, but not limited to this.
在主板與子板為連接前,主板上元件的運作係由多」 控制器(11)讀取預先儲存於E2PR0M (12)中的資料,妳 後藉由排線F1(112)將指令傳達至無線通訊模組(14) 了 線通訊模組(14)得以運作進行無線傳輸作業。 接二不同經模組化的子板⑴日寺,子板⑴可藉由$ 接益B (25)與連接器A (15)的連接使子板(2)上的 通道進人主板⑴。主板⑴可藉由子板⑵的插 拔動作開關EPROM (12)的切換晶片插腳(csBefore the main board and the daughter board are connected, the operation of the components on the main board is performed by multiple controllers (11) that read the data stored in E2PR0M (12) in advance, and then you use the cable F1 (112) to transmit the instructions Wireless communication module (14) The line communication module (14) can operate for wireless transmission. Connected to two different modular daughter boards ⑴ 日 寺, the daughter board ⑴ can make the channel on the daughter board (2) enter the motherboard ⑴ through the connection of Jieyi B (25) and connector A (15). The motherboard ⑴ can be switched by the plug-in action switch EPROM (12) of the daughter board 晶片.

=),以使多工控制器(11)得以選擇讀取主板(1)上預先儲 存於E2PROM (12)中的資料或是讀取子板(2)上預先儲存於 E2PROM (24)中的資料。 上述之多工控制器(11)可支援多種模式,在此可列舉 出_數個實例如表一所示,表一中模式一〜三為多工模式, 杈式四〜六為單工模式之實例。多工控制器(丨丨)可藉由此 模組的變化來達成其多工之目的。=), So that the multiplexing controller (11) can choose to read the data pre-stored in the E2PROM (12) on the motherboard (1) or read the pre-stored data in the E2PROM (24) on the daughter board (2). data. The above-mentioned multiplexing controller (11) can support multiple modes. Here are a few examples. As shown in Table 1, Modes 1 to 3 in Table 1 are multiplexed modes, and Modes 4 to 6 are simplex modes. Examples. The multiplexing controller (丨 丨) can achieve its multiplexing purpose through the change of this module.
頃取自子板(2 )上的資訊,例如取自E2 pR〇M ( 2 4 )、記 憶卡轉接器(22)或無線通訊模組(2 3)的資訊,可經由兩條 路徑自連接器A (15)傳輸至多工控制器(11)的排線匕 (111)’進入多工控制器(11)來執行無線通訊卡的運作。 其:一路徑為自連接器A (15)經匯流排B2 (162)進入SSD裝 ,橋接晶片(13),再經由匯流排Βι (161)傳送至多工控制 杰(11)’另一路經為自連接器A (1 5)經匯流排c (1 6 3)直接 傳送至多工控制器(11)而不經過SSD裝置橋接晶片(13)。 自子板(2)傳入主板(1)資訊可藉由切換晶片(未顯示)來選 擇經由哪一條路徑來傳送。Information from the daughter board (2), such as information from E2 pROM (2 4), memory card adapter (22), or wireless communication module (2 3), can be obtained from two paths The connector A (15) is transmitted to the cable dagger (111) 'of the multiplexing controller (11) and enters the multiplexing controller (11) to perform the operation of the wireless communication card. Its one path is from the connector A (15) to the SSD device via the bus B2 (162), the bridge chip (13), and then transmitted to the multiplexer control jack (11) via the bus Bι (161). The other path is The self-connector A (1 5) is directly transmitted to the multiplexing controller (11) via the bus c (1 6 3) without passing through the SSD device bridge chip (13). Information transferred from the daughter board (2) to the motherboard (1) can be switched by switching the chip (not shown).
上述SSD裝置橋接晶片(13)的主要功能,係在於將可 插拔之子板(2)上的資訊,如SD、MMC、MS…等,經由SS]) 裝置橋接晶片(13)傳送至真實整合驅動電子界面(True · IDE) ’其作用如同於一般記憶體擴充卡(pers〇nai Computer Memory Card International Association, PCMC I A)轉接器的作用一般。 河述E2PR〇M (12)(24)主要的功能,包含:(1)儲存The main function of the above-mentioned SSD device bridge chip (13) is to transmit the information on the pluggable daughter board (2), such as SD, MMC, MS, etc., to the real integration through the SS]) device bridge chip (13) Driven Electronic Interface (True · IDE) 'Its function is the same as that of a general memory expansion card (personai Computer Memory Card International Association, PCMC IA) adapter. Heshu E2PR〇M (12) (24) The main functions include: (1) storage
1222827 五、發明說明(6) PCMCIA 之卡片資料結構(card informati〇n Structure, CIS);及(2)儲存一設置值,準備來設定(c〇nf ig)此多工 控制器’以決定該多工控制器工作於何種模式(丨丨)。例 如EPROM 93C56共有256位元組(bytes),其中從〇〇〜EF放1222827 V. Description of the invention (6) PCMCIA card information structure (CIS); and (2) store a set value and prepare to set (conn ig) this multiplexer controller to determine the What mode does the multiplexer controller work in (丨 丨). For example, EPROM 93C56 has a total of 256 bytes (bytes).
置卡片資料結構(CIS),設定此e2PR〇M 93C56晶片的設定 值’如表二所示。亦即,當啟動電源後,E2PR〇m 93C56所 $的資料會輸入至多工控制器,其中會有24〇位元組的CIS 貢料駐存於隨機存取記憶體(RAM buf fer)中;另外16位元 、且則用以5又疋此多工控制器,然後系統主機端會送重置 訊號(reset signal )到卡端,以決定此多工控制器工作於 哪一種杈式,緊接著系統主機端,會藉由隨機夺取記憶體 内的暫存240位元組的CIS資料,以決定此卡工作於作業系 統(Operation System,os)時為何種功能之卡片。亦即, 其係先透過設定16位元組資料及主機端的重置訊號以決定 晶片為何種功用,且之後作業系統會再設定此卡於 Win98/2K/CE中有何功能。 、Set the card data structure (CIS), and set the settings of the e2PROM 93C56 chip as shown in Table 2. That is, when the power is turned on, the data stored in E2PRom 93C56 will be input to the multiplexing controller, and a 240-byte CIS tribute will reside in the RAM buf fer; The other 16-bit and 5 are used for this multiplexing controller, and then the host side of the system will send a reset signal to the card end to determine which branch type this multiplexing controller works in. The host of the system will randomly capture the 240-bit CIS data temporarily stored in the memory to determine what kind of function the card will be when operating in the operating system (OS). That is, it first determines the function of the chip by setting 16-bit data and the reset signal on the host side, and then the operating system will set what functions this card has in Win98 / 2K / CE. ,
